The Joy of Toy Cars A Perfect Drive for 10-Year-Olds
Toy cars have been a cherished part of childhood for generations, providing endless opportunities for imaginative play and creativity. For 10-year-olds, the experience of playing with toy cars offers not only fun but also valuable lessons in patience, fine motor skills, and spatial awareness. In this article, we will explore the various types of toy cars that are perfect for 10-year-olds, why they continue to captivate the minds of children, and the benefits they offer.

The act of playing with toy cars fosters essential skills in children. As they set up tracks and obstacle courses, they learn about cause and effect—how a car's speed can influence its trajectory. Arranging cars in different configurations supports cognitive development and enhances problem-solving abilities. Additionally, manipulating small toy cars helps refine fine motor skills. Children practice hand-eye coordination as they navigate their cars around obstacles and through tricky turns.
Moreover, toy car play can be a social activity, inspiring collaborative play among friends and siblings. When kids gather to race or trade cars, they develop social skills such as sharing, cooperation, and communication. Creating car tracks together encourages teamwork and compromises, giving children invaluable experience in resolving conflicts and working towards a common goal.
Imaginary scenarios can also be sparked when children engage with their toy cars. They might create entire cities and stories, giving each car a unique identity, backstory, and purpose. This unstructured playtime is crucial for cognitive development, as it encourages creativity and critical thinking. Children must think ahead, devise plots, and invent characters, making playtime not just about the toys, but about building worlds and narratives.
Safety is an essential factor to consider when selecting toy cars for this age group. Most reputable brands ensure that their products meet safety standards, providing peace of mind for parents. Some vehicles are designed with durability in mind, able to withstand rough play, which is often the case for 10-year-olds. Options include die-cast metal cars, plastic models, and even remote-controlled vehicles that add another dimension of engagement and excitement.
In conclusion, toy cars are much more than simple playthings; they are gateways to creativity, learning, and social interaction for 10-year-olds. With a variety of options available and numerous developmental benefits, it is no wonder that toy cars continue to be a popular choice among children. By encouraging imaginative play and providing hands-on experiences, toy cars help shape young minds, making them a timeless and valuable aspect of childhood. Whether racing down tracks or exploring imaginary worlds, toy cars promise hours of entertainment and skills development that enrich a child's formative years.
